Unveiling Hidden Gems: Off-the-Beaten-Path Destinations

While popular tourist destinations offer undeniable appeal, venturing off the beaten path can lead to truly unforgettable experiences. Consider exploring lesser-known regions that boast stunning natural beauty, rich cultural heritage, and a more authentic atmosphere. Countries like Slovenia, with its picturesque lakes and charming villages, or Georgia, with its ancient monasteries and vibrant culinary scene, offer unique alternatives to overcrowded tourist hotspots. Beyond Europe, destinations like Bhutan, renowned for its commitment to Gross National Happiness, or Palawan in the Philippines, with its pristine beaches and turquoise waters, provide opportunities for immersive and enriching travel experiences. These destinations often offer a better value for money and a chance to connect with local communities on a deeper level.

The Appeal of Sustainable Tourism

Increasingly, travelers are seeking out sustainable tourism options that minimize their environmental impact and support local economies. This includes choosing eco-friendly accommodations, participating in responsible tours, and respecting local customs and traditions. Sustainable tourism not only benefits the environment but also enhances the travel experience by fostering a sense of connection with the destination and its people. Look for certifications like Travelife or Green Globe, which indicate that a travel provider is committed to sustainable practices. Small, locally-owned businesses also often prioritize sustainability and offer a more authentic and enriching experience than large multinational corporations.

The Rise of Budget Airlines and Alternative Transit

The rise of budget airlines has made air travel more accessible to a wider range of travelers. However, it’s important to be aware of the potential hidden costs, such as baggage fees and seat selection charges. Alternative transit options, such as overnight trains and long-distance buses, can offer a more scenic and affordable way to travel between cities. These options are particularly popular in Europe and Asia, where extensive rail and bus networks connect major destinations. Consider utilizing ride-sharing services, such as Uber or Lyft, for convenient and affordable transportation within cities. However, be sure to check the local regulations and ensure that the service is licensed and insured.

Accommodation Choices: Finding Your Home Away From Home

Selecting the right accommodation is crucial for a comfortable and enjoyable trip. From budget-friendly hostels to luxurious hotels, the options are endless. Consider your budget, travel style, and desired level of comfort when making your choice. Hostels are a great option for solo travelers and backpackers who are looking to meet new people and save money. Hotels offer more privacy and amenities, but they typically come with a higher price tag. Alternatively, consider renting an apartment or house through platforms like Airbnb or Vrbo, which can provide a more authentic and immersive experience. When choosing accommodation, read reviews from other travelers to get an unbiased perspective. Pay attention to factors such as location, cleanliness, and security.
